I remember this now! I forget most of the details, but the girl's parents (or whoever) become convinced that she's evil. They plan a trip to a lake, telling her that it will be fun and as the episode ends, she looks into the mirror and sees water rising up over her head and in a sad voice repeats "Goodbye, goodbye..."

It was the second episode of the third season of Tale from the Darkside, called I Can't Help Saying Goodbye
